Average Special Education Teachers, Secondary School Salary in Aguadilla, PR

The average salary for a Special Education Teachers, Secondary School in Aguadilla, PR is $57,960.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market. Notably, Aguadilla, PR is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 2.71x higher than average.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Special Education Teachers, Secondary School make in Aguadilla, PR?

The median annual salary for a Special Education Teachers, Secondary School in Aguadilla, PR is $57,960. This typically ranges from $49,310 for entry-level positions to $70,010 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Aguadilla, PR is 5.6% lower than the national median of $61,380.
